CAPriCORN Patient Community Advisory Committee Awarded Eugene Washington Patient-Centered Outcomes Research Institute Engagement Award

CAPriCORN’s Patient Community Advisory Committee (PCAC) was awarded the Eugene Washington Patient-Centered Outcomes Research Institute (PCORI) Engagement Award for Conference Support in support of their conference proposal, “Elevating the Patient Voice in Research.” The grant enabled the PCAC to plan and implement the project, which is designed to increase patient participation in research and to guide future health research priorities.

PCAC members listed on the grant have met with partners to develop and disseminate a community survey and plan three community listening sessions. At these sessions, community members will share their thoughts on health issues important to them and what information is needed to address those issues. Session dates are as follows:

Based upon its intimate knowledge of CAPriCORN, PCAC is uniquely positioned to leverage the conference opportunity to develop and strengthen strategic relationships with patients, community partners, key stakeholders, and governmental leaders (“consumers”). CAPriCORN will support the PCAC and the Health and Medicine Policy Research Group Collaborators as this conference is developed and actualized.

As a part of this effort they developed a survey (included below) to collect the opinions on the social conditions and health issues that are of most interest to patients and community members in Cook County.  The information collected from the survey will be used to guide the series of community listening sessions.
